Job Description

Overall Job Purpose

To support the Internal Controls team in delivering effective control governance by assisting with progressive evidencing, sampling, assessments, reporting, and coordination across the MENA and SSA r egions. The intern will contribute to the execution and documentation of the Internal Controls Framework (ICF), audit preparedness, and continuous improvement of compliance processes.

.Responsibilities are performed under close supervision with appropriate training and guidance.

Key Responsibilities

  • Perform progressive evidencing activities, including downloading and reviewing bi weekly ICS reports from iCON and ensuring documents are appropriately stored and referenced.
  • Assist in progressive assessments, including running tool sample selections (e.g. ARAS), downloading populations from ICS, preparing sample templates, and tracking completion.
  • Update and maintain Internal Controls tracking dashboards and internal files daily/weekly (e.g., evidence trackers, submission logs)
  • Support the execution of assessments across key processes: Order to Cash, Purchase to Pay, Record to Report, Fixed & Intangible Assets, Commercial processes, and others.
  • Prepare and send weekly status updates to Process Owners and Persons-in-Charge.
  • Coordinate with regional and country teams to follow up on outstanding evidence, issues, or sample clarifications.
  • Liaise with cross-functional teams (Finance, Operations, Compliance) to support control testing requirements
  • Assist in the preparation of monthly control activity summaries, including time allocation, progress reports, and variance explanations.
  • Support audit readiness efforts by organising documentation for internal and external auditors, as required.
  • Maintain clear, structured, and audit-ready control documentation.
  • Assist in identifying minor process gaps or inconsistencies in documentation during evidence reviews.
  • Provide input to enhance templates, trackers, and standard operating procedures.
  • Support initiatives related to digitalisation, automation, and data accuracy within the Internal Controls function.
  • Work collaboratively with the Internal Controls team by aligning on timelines, supporting shared deliverables, participating in team discussions, and ensuring clear communication to maintain smooth operational flow.

About Company

DHL is a German logistics company providing courier, package delivery and express mail service, which is a division of the German logistics firm Deutsche Post. The company group delivers over 1.6 billion parcels per year. DHL Express is market leader for parcel services in Europe and Germany's main Courier and Parcel Service.
The company DHL itself was founded in San Francisco, United States, in 1969 and expanded its service throughout the world by the late 1970s. In 1979, under the name of DHL Air Cargo, the company entered the Hawaiian islands with an inter-island cargo service using two DC-3 and four DC-6 aircraft. Adrian Dalsey and Larry Hillblom personally oversaw the daily operations until its eventual bankruptcy closed the doors in 1983. At its peak, DHL Air Cargo employed just over 100 workers, management and pilots.
